These Spicy Bacon Cheese Pinwheels are the ultimate savory bite — filled with crispy bacon, gooey mozzarella, and a touch of heat from spicy green chilies, all rolled up in buttery pizza dough. Perfect for parties, game nights, or as an easy appetizer everyone will love!
Step 1 – Prepare Ingredients: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C). Gather all your ingredients and prepare the bacon and chilies.
Step 2 – Roll Out Dough: Roll the pizza crust on a lightly floured surface to 1/4 inch thick.
Step 3 – Brush with Butter: Melt butter and brush evenly over the dough.
Step 4 – Add Cheese: Sprinkle Parmesan and mozzarella cheese evenly across the dough.
Step 5 – Add Bacon and Chilies: Scatter crumbled bacon and diced green chilies over the top.
Step 6 – Roll and Slice: Roll the dough tightly into a log and slice into 1-inch pinwheels.
Step 7 – Bake: Arrange slices on a parchment-lined baking sheet and bake for 15–20 minutes or until golden brown.
Step 8 – Serve: Let cool slightly and serve warm with ranch dressing, salsa, or spicy aioli.
Notes
These pinwheels are best served warm. Store leftovers in an airtight container for up to 3 days or freeze before baking for up to 1 month. Reheat in the oven for a crisp texture.
